Novel organoboron polymers were prepared by alkoxyboration polymerizat
ion of diisocyanates with mesityldimethoxyborane. The polymers obtaine
d have boronic carbamate in their repeating units and can be expected
as a novel type of reactive polymers. First, alkoxyboration polymeriza
tion between mesityldimethoxyborane and 1,6-hexamethylene diisocyanate
was examined, and the best reaction condition was optimized to be 140
degrees C in bulk. Both aliphatic and aromatic diisocyanates gave the
corresponding polymers. When aromatic diisocyanates were employed, th
e reactions required severe reaction conditions (150 degrees C). The p
olymers prepared from aromatic diisocyanates have a high stability tow
ard air. Among various boron monomers, mesityldimethoxyborane was foun
d to be the most suitable monomer for the present polymerization syste
m.
